Anyway, I ran home (literally, I walk to Blick from my new digs - so I'm sure there was a hop in my step on the return trip) I busted out the new pencils and started coloring. Yep, they were neon - some of the shades are more 'bright' than others... but, I think they work really well together.

I created a background 'neon rainbow' with the colored pencils and blended them a bit with mineral spirits -


You know what else is so cool about this card?! (other than the sequence of course!) I used my neon ink (the hero arts inks) and stamped them on vellum - then I just put some clear embossing powder over it. It looked so pretty! I ended up LOVING this cityscape!!

I also used my favorite - Freckled Fawn wood pieces (the stars) and I just colored them with my neon Copics. Bam - Neon Cityscape - DONE!

We've Moved Card.  There are so many reasons that I love SSS stamps.  One of the main reasons is how perfect they are to make some really striking cards that are super fast and easy.  When making moving announcements, you often have to make A LOT so one layer is the way to go in my book.  I used some Jenni Bowlin brown ink as my primary color for the sentiment and outline then stamped the solid building images in a red and turquoise.  Then it's done!  How fun and easy is that?!?!?




A Day in the City Card.  This is another single layer card with some fun twists.  I love the idea of two step stamping (i.e. you stamp a solid image and then the outline or vise versa).  So I made my own sold image "stamps" based on the outline stamps using some craft foam and Xyron repositional adhesive.  Easy peasy.  And then I paired the building image with some hand drawn cars I learned from my old school Ed Emberly books.
